Doorbell surveillance systems

Smart doorbell systems come equipped with video surveillance, allowing property owners to track the number of guests coming and going from the location. If you are worried about guests breaking your no-pet rules or bringing extra visitors they didn’t pay for, this smart home gadget will keep your property under control while you are away.

Airbnb hosts are also allowed to have exterior security cameras, so you can install them, for example, in your front yard or patio. However, you must disclose their location to guests. However, hosts are prohibited from monitoring their guests in areas where people have a greater expectation of privacy, such as inside an enclosed outdoor shower or in a sauna. Keep in mind that Airbnb recently updated its camera policy and banned the use of security cameras inside listings.

Smart locks

Having old-fashioned physical keys for your property can be risky because guests often lose them or fail to return the key upon check-out. Smart locks add another layer of security and ensure keyless entry to your home or apartment, so you can offer your guests self-check-in and will be able to manage your Airbnb remotely.

Airbnb allows hosts to send unique passcodes to guests through the app just a few days before they’re expected to arrive, giving them temporary access to the property. The passcode expires after the arranged check-out time.

Carbon monoxide and smoke detector

Carbon monoxide and smoke detectors are essential devices for potentially life-threatening situations. Your guests will feel much more at ease when these systems are installed. Airbnb encourages all hosts to install smoke and CO detectors in their rental spaces. They also provide one free device to anyone with an active listing—only one per host. But if your property is very large, you may need more than one of these devices for complete safety.

Noise detector

If you're not comfortable with your guests having a party in the house, you may want to consider using smart devices and apps to maintain control. Noise monitoring software like Minut and Alertify can’t identify or record individual sounds. Such devices measure decibel levels over time to help keep your home safe and avoid neighbor complaints while respecting your guests’ privacy.

Noise sensors allow you to detect the exact noise level happening at your rental property at any given moment. Such devices can help avoid sticky situations with neighbors and even the police. They will notify you if an unusually noisy situation is occurring so you can intervene.

Airbnb allows hosts to install noise decibel monitors inside their rental properties, provided that hosts disclose the location of these devices. But you cannot install them in bedrooms, bathrooms, and sleeping areas.

Motion sensors

If you use your rental property as a home for yourself during certain times of the year, motion sensors can help you restrict certain parts. Smart motion detectors will send notifications to alert you when guests enter these restricted areas. As long as motion sensors aren’t equipped with video or photo cameras and audio monitors, they’re completely fair game.

Smart thermostat

This device can make controlling the temperatures of your space much easier because you can monitor and adjust the temperature settings remotely from anywhere. A smart thermostat can help keep your Airbnb at a comfortable temperature and may be a selling point for potential guests, especially if your property is located in a country with extreme weather conditions. Smart thermostats can also help you save on your bills because they are eco-friendly and prevent energy waste, while providing every guest with comfort upon arrival.

The best smart thermostats for Airbnb come equipped with occupancy sensors and may have other safety features like built-in smoke alarm detection and freeze detection. They may also connect with various smart home systems.
